How to attach tumi luggage tag
To attach a Tumi luggage tag to your suitcase or bag, follow these steps:
1. Locate the small metal attachment ring on the back of the luggage tag.
2. Open the attachment ring by gently pulling the two ends apart.
3. Slip the ring through the handle of your suitcase or bag, and then release the ring to close it securely around the handle.
4. Adjust the tag so that it hangs straight and is easily readable.
Note: Tumi luggage tags come with a card inside to fill out personal information, make sure to fill it out before attaching the tag to your luggage.

How to attach luggage tag at airport
1. Locate the baggage tag dispenser at the airport check-in counter or self-service kiosk.
2. Take a tag and fill out the required information, including your name, address, and flight information.
3. Remove the old tag if any still attached to your luggage
4. Attach the newly filled out tag to the handle or a prominent location on your luggage using the string or loop provided on the tag.
5. Double-check to make sure the tag is securely attached and the information is legible.
6. Proceed to check in your luggage and give it to the airline representative.

Why luggage tag is so important?
Luggage tags are important for several reasons:
1. Identification: A luggage tag helps identify your suitcase as yours and differentiates it from other similar looking suitcases.
2. Return of lost luggage: If your luggage gets lost during travel, the information on your luggage tag can help the airline or airport personnel locate you and return the suitcase to you.
3. Security: Luggage tags can also help deter theft, as they make it more difficult for someone to take a suitcase without being noticed.
4. Compliance with regulations: Some airlines and train companies require that you have a tag on your luggage before they will accept it for travel.
5. Smart luggage tags: With the advancement of technology, smart luggage tags are also gaining popularity, which can track your luggage in real-time, so you know where it is at all times.
Overall, Luggage tags are a simple yet effective way to ensure the safety and security of your luggage during travel and increase the chances of recovering it if it gets lost.

Attaching cruise luggage tags is a simple process. Here are the steps you can follow to properly attach your cruise luggage tags:
1. Locate the cruise luggage tags: Most cruise lines will provide you with luggage tags in the mail or at check-in.
2. Fill in the information: Make sure to fill out all the necessary information on the tag, such as your name, stateroom number, and the ship’s name.
3. Attach the tag to your luggage: Most cruise lines will require you to attach the tag to the handle of your suitcase using the string or plastic loop that is provided. Some cruise lines may also require you to attach the tag to the suitcase with a paperclip. Make sure that the tag is securely fastened and not easily removable.
4. Repeat for all your luggage: Make sure to attach a tag to all of your luggage, including carry-on bags and backpacks.
5. Hand over your luggage: Once you have attached the tags to your luggage, you can hand over your luggage to the porter who will take it to your stateroom.
It is important to check with your specific cruise line for their specific luggage tagging requirements as some cruise lines may have different procedures.

How does electronic luggage tag work?
An electronic luggage tag is a device that attaches to a suitcase or other piece of luggage and uses RFID technology to store information about the bag, such as the owner’s name, flight information, and destination. When the bag is checked at the airport, the information on the electronic tag is scanned and sent to the airline’s baggage tracking system, allowing the bag to be tracked as it makes its way through the airport and onto the plane.
Some electronic luggage tags also have a display screen that can show the flight information or other information. This eliminates the need for traditional paper luggage tag and eliminates the risk of losing the tag.

Where should i put my luggage tag in my luggage?
It is typically recommended to attach the luggage tag to the handle or top of the bag, so that it is easily visible to airport personnel when the bag is being checked in and loaded onto the plane. It is also important to make sure that the tag is securely fastened to the bag and that the information on the tag is easily readable.
Some electronic luggage tags are designed to be placed inside the luggage and can be scanned through a transparent window or a special compartment in the luggage. However, it’s always better to double check with the airline or the airport about the specific requirements for attaching electronic tags as it may vary between airlines and airports.
